The SAKURA Gelly Roll Gel Pens 6-pack features archival-quality black gel ink that resists bleeding and fading, with a fine 0.3mm tip for detailed journaling, drawing, and art. Crafted by Sakura, the gel ink pioneers, these pens combine smooth ink flow and reliable Japanese quality in a sleek, comfortable design.

Best pens I've ever used
Not only are these gel pens aesthetically pleasing, they also work very well! I know they are a bit pricey, but I do enjoy using these gel pens. The ink is pigmented (which is a great thing for me; I like when my pens have dark ink), and the shape of the pen is comfortable in the hand. I have wrote with these pens for a whole day (I am a writer and I journal), and my hand didn't cramp due to fatigue (like some other pens I have used before).I recommend these pens! I love them! The only con is they are not quick drying, so depending on what type of paper you use, it will smear. The smoother the paper the higher chance of smearing. For example, first, I used a Rhodia A4 size, dotted pad; and the pens did smear. Then, I used some typical college ruled Oxford paper, and the pens did not smear.

Remove the coating!
Hahaha bought these for my husband and he came to me and said none of them worked!! 🤣 while I was looking for another pen for him to use I remembered when we used gel pens at my work they had a little plastic coating over the tip when you first went to use them. So I went and checked and sure enough these did too.. 🙃 hahaha he felt foolish for not finding it but after it was removed the pens worked very well!
